summaryrefslogtreecommitdiff
path: root/include/svx
diff options
context:
space:
mode:
authorManal Alhassoun <malhassoun@kacst.edu.sa>2013-09-30 11:22:50 +0300
committerCaolán McNamara <caolanm@redhat.com>2013-10-01 09:55:52 +0000
commitff3203c5c567ed14a8ff2e80408c304d3cdd84e0 (patch)
tree178f9ccc0046dfb31a015661bdb234c2002c7018 /include/svx
parent5249bd69ff7fa41d785a5bf9f4e7539ef8288438 (diff)
Convert change password dialog to widget UI
Change-Id: I0ff0eda77b849927fe6cffe5cf203c46ba9ef340 Reviewed-on: https://gerrit.libreoffice.org/6089 Reviewed-by: Caolán McNamara <caolanm@redhat.com> Tested-by: Caolán McNamara <caolanm@redhat.com>
Diffstat (limited to 'include/svx')
-rw-r--r--include/svx/dialogs.hrc3
-rw-r--r--include/svx/passwd.hxx21
2 files changed, 10 insertions, 14 deletions
diff --git a/include/svx/dialogs.hrc b/include/svx/dialogs.hrc
index 4c1ba17fd05c..4c3d681016f7 100644
--- a/include/svx/dialogs.hrc
+++ b/include/svx/dialogs.hrc
@@ -200,7 +200,6 @@
// for Toolbox-Control style
#define RID_SVXTBX_STYLE (RID_SVX_START + 120)
-#define RID_SVXDLG_PASSWORD (RID_SVX_START + 141)
#define RID_SVXDLG_COMPRESSGRAPHICS (RID_SVX_START + 142)
// Dialog for functions
@@ -995,6 +994,8 @@
#define RID_SVXSTR_DOC_MODIFIED_YES (SVX_OOO_BUILD_START + 4) // 1234
#define RID_SVXSTR_DOC_MODIFIED_NO (SVX_OOO_BUILD_START + 5) // 1235
#define RID_SVXSTR_DOC_LOAD (SVX_OOO_BUILD_START + 6) // 1236
+#define RID_SVXSTR_ERR_OLD_PASSWD (SVX_OOO_BUILD_START + 7) // 1237
+#define RID_SVXSTR_ERR_REPEAT_PASSWD (SVX_OOO_BUILD_START + 8) // 1238
// sidebar-related resources (defined in the appropriate .hrc's)
#define RID_SVX_SIDEBAR_BEGIN (RID_SVX_START + 1240)
diff --git a/include/svx/passwd.hxx b/include/svx/passwd.hxx
index 532ee6e0170b..1009597dd77d 100644
--- a/include/svx/passwd.hxx
+++ b/include/svx/passwd.hxx
@@ -33,17 +33,12 @@
class SVX_DLLPUBLIC SvxPasswordDialog : public SfxModalDialog
{
private:
- FixedLine aOldFL;
- FixedText aOldPasswdFT;
- Edit aOldPasswdED;
- FixedLine aNewFL;
- FixedText aNewPasswdFT;
- Edit aNewPasswdED;
- FixedText aRepeatPasswdFT;
- Edit aRepeatPasswdED;
- OKButton aOKBtn;
- CancelButton aEscBtn;
- HelpButton aHelpBtn;
+ FixedText* m_pOldFL;
+ FixedText* m_pOldPasswdFT;
+ Edit* m_pOldPasswdED;
+ Edit* m_pNewPasswdED;
+ Edit* m_pRepeatPasswdED;
+ OKButton* m_pOKBtn;
OUString aOldPasswdErrStr;
OUString aRepeatPasswdErrStr;
@@ -59,8 +54,8 @@ public:
SvxPasswordDialog( Window* pParent, sal_Bool bAllowEmptyPasswords = sal_False, sal_Bool bDisableOldPassword = sal_False );
~SvxPasswordDialog();
- OUString GetOldPassword() const { return aOldPasswdED.GetText(); }
- OUString GetNewPassword() const { return aNewPasswdED.GetText(); }
+ OUString GetOldPassword() const { return m_pOldPasswdED->GetText(); }
+ OUString GetNewPassword() const { return m_pNewPasswdED->GetText(); }
void SetCheckPasswordHdl( const Link& rLink ) { aCheckPasswordHdl = rLink; }
};